The Radiomir 1940 3 Days PAM 00690: A Classic Reimagined
The Panerai Radiomir 1940 3 Days PAM 00690 represents a pinnacle of understated elegance within the Panerai collection. Its classic Radiomir 1940 case design, with its cushion-shaped profile and wire lugs, exudes a timeless charm. The addition of the deep blue sunburst dial elevates this already iconic watch to a new level of sophistication. The sunburst effect, created by meticulously brushing the dial in a radial pattern, produces a captivating play of light and shadow, making the dial appear to shimmer and change subtly depending on the angle of light. The three-day power reserve, a hallmark of many Panerai models, ensures convenient wearability without the need for frequent winding. Luminor Marina and Luminor 1950: Modern Interpretations of a Legendary Design
Moving beyond the Radiomir, the Panerai Luminor Marina and Luminor 1950 lines showcase the versatility of the blue sunburst dial in more contemporary settings. The Panerai Luminor Marina New 2025 44mm Blue Sunburst Dial, for example, embodies the modern Panerai aesthetic. The robust 44mm case, the iconic crown-protecting bridge, and the luminous markers all contribute to its instantly recognizable design. The blue sunburst dial, however, adds a touch of refined elegance that distinguishes it from its more utilitarian predecessors. Similarly, the Panerai Luminor 1950 GMT Sunburst Blue Dial Stainless Steel showcases the brand’s commitment to both heritage and innovation. The GMT complication adds functionality without compromising the watch's inherent style. The blue sunburst dial, in this context, complements the watch's sophisticated features.
The Panerai Luminor Marina PAM00069 Date Steel Blue Sunburst exemplifies the enduring appeal of this classic combination. This model offers a more accessible entry point into the world of Panerai blue sunburst watches, while still retaining the brand’s unmistakable DNA. The date complication adds practical functionality, making it a versatile daily wearer.
